Detailed Description

The ECM15DRKS-S13 is a high-performance board-to-board PCB connector designed for reliable power and signal transmission in demanding applications. Featuring a sturdy construction with PBT and phosphor bronze materials, it ensures durability in harsh environments. With an amperage rating of 5A and a voltage capacity of 950VAC, this connector offers efficient power delivery. Its female gender, 2 rows, and side-hole mount type make it versatile for various connectivity needs. The termination method of card extender and full bellow contact type guarantee secure and stable connections. Gold-plated phosphor bronze contacts and matte tin termination plating ensure excellent conductivity and corrosion resistance. With 30 positions and a pitch of 3.96mm, it provides ample connectivity options. Operating in a wide temperature range from -65 to 125°C, this connector is suitable for use in extreme conditions. Its compact size, with dimensions of 10.95mm in height and 8.26mm in width, makes it ideal for space-constrained PCB layouts.
